Every smile starts with an initial consultation!

Your initial consultation will give you the opportunity to meet our team, learn more about orthodontics, receive a complete initial exam and find out which treatment options will best meet your needs.

During your initial consultation, we will:

  • Review your dental and medical history forms
  • Discuss with you the reason why you want braces or orthodontic treatment
  • Provide a complete oral exam, with X-rays (if needed), to determine treatment options
  • Help you create a customized treatment plan
  • Go over all financial information, insurance options, and payment plans

What happens after the initial consultation?

You’re one step closer to achieving the smile you’ve always wanted! After your consultation, we will schedule your first appointment and our team will place your braces on. The whole appointment will take about an hour: 45 minutes to put on the braces and about 15 minutes to go over how to brush, floss and take care of your braces.

Visiting the dentist during orthodontic treatment

It is very important that you continue to visit your family dentist once every six months, even during your orthodontic treatment, for teeth cleanings and routine dental checkups. If extra dental care is needed, we will be happy to coordinate with your family dentist to make sure that you are receiving the best care possible.
